As the automotive industry pivots towards sustainability, luxury electric vehicles have emerged as a central figure in this transformation. With sales projected to increase sharply in the coming years, particularly in regions like Southeast Asia, manufacturers are racing to innovate and capture market share. Notably, countries within the ASEAN region, such as Indonesia, are setting ambitious goals for electric vehicle adoption, presenting opportunities for luxury brands to expand their presence.
Recent developments in battery technology are revolutionizing the luxury EV segment. Brands are investing heavily in research to extend battery life and enhance charging speeds. For instance, the integration of solid-state batteries is seen as a game-changer, potentially allowing vehicles to travel further on a single charge.
Moreover, advancements in autonomous driving technology are steering luxury EVs towards a new frontier. As companies test and roll out these features, they are also addressing the safety and regulatory challenges that come with such innovations.
Today's consumers are not only looking for high-performance vehicles but are increasingly concerned about their environmental impact. A recent survey indicated that over 70% of luxury car buyers are willing to pay a premium for sustainable options. This trend is particularly pronounced among younger generations, who prioritize brands that align with their values.
Governments across Southeast Asia are offering incentives to encourage the adoption of electric vehicles. Countries like Indonesia are providing tax breaks and subsidies for electric vehicle buyers, while also investing in the necessary infrastructure to support charging stations. These policies are crucial for fostering a conducive environment for luxury brands looking to introduce their EV models in these markets.
